Particle size can be measured using techniques like dynamic light scattering, laser diffraction, or microscopy. These methods analyze the scattering or diffraction of light to determine the size distribution of particles in a sample. Each technique has its own advantages and limitations, so the choice of method depends on the specific properties of the particles being measured.

Particle size refers to the overall size of the individual particles in a material, while crystallite size specifically refers to the size of the crystalline regions within a material. Crystallite size is related to the arrangement of atoms within a material, while particle size is a more general measure of the physical dimensions of the particles.

As particle size increases, capillarity decreases because larger particles have lower surface area-to-volume ratio, reducing the ability to draw in and hold water through capillary action. This is because larger particles have less surface area available for water to cling to compared to smaller particles.
Clastic sedimentary rocks are primarily classified based on the size of the particles they are composed of. These rocks are categorized into different groups such as gravel, sand, silt, or clay, depending on the size of the fragments they contain. The classification helps in understanding the environment in which the rocks were formed and the processes involved in their deposition and lithification.
Particle size affects solubility. When particle size is small, the surface area per unit volume is larger, thus the solubility is increased.

The formula for mean particle size is calculated by summing the individual particle sizes and dividing by the total number of particles. Mathematically, it is expressed as mean particle size = (Σ particle sizes) / total number of particles.
A particle size analyzer is a scientific device which measures the size of any grains or particles found in a given sample that is taken to be measured.A particle size analyzer is a piece of scientific equipment. It checks for size, shape, concentration and distribution of a specific particle in an item. On basis of the different principles being used, a common type is the "laser diffraction particle size analyzer."
